빌런 TOP 20
일간 l 주간 l 월간
1
[인플루언서/BJ] 넷플릭스 불량연애 출연자 과거 논란
2
[성인정보] 현재 성인 웹툰 추천 티어표
3
[이슈/논란] [충격] 유명 런닝화 호카 총판 대표 폭력, 하청업체 관계자 폐건물로 불러 폭행
4
[인공지능] 구글, AI 프로 요금제 59% 할인
5
[르포/기획] 2025년 게이밍 PC용 메인보드 추천 6선
6
[PC게임] 란스 시리즈 - 스팀판 트레일러
7
[컴퓨터] MSI 엔비디아 RTX 5090 그래픽카드, 16핀 전원 커넥터 실화로 손상
8
[설문조사] [빌런 설문조사] 가장 가지고 싶은 30만원 이하 27인치 QHD 게이밍 모니터는?
9
[PC게임] [2025 BEST 게임 어워드] Escape from Duckov - 덕코프 행복 줍줍 게임
10
[컴퓨터] AMD 9950X3D2 CPU 벤치마크 결과 유출
11
[컴퓨터] 메모리 공급 부족 사태 마이크로소프트 경영진 격분, 구글은 구매 책임자 해고
12
[모바일] 삼성전자, 독자 GPU 개발 성공...AI 생태계 확장
13
[게임] 2026년 게임시장 판을 흔들 출시작
14
[가전] 삼성 프리스타일+ 휴대용 프로젝터, CES 2026 첫 공개 예정
15
[컴퓨터] 삼성전자, ‘갤럭시 북6 시리즈’ 공개
16
[이벤트] 1월 베스트 빌런 댓글러를 찾습니다.
17
[컴퓨터] D램 메모리 제조사, 고객 ‘선별 공급’ 단계로 진입
18
[후방/은꼴] 스타워즈를 참 좋아합니다.
19
[컴퓨터] AMD 차세대 RDNA 5 라데온 GPU, 2027년 중반 출시 전망
20
[이벤트] 슈퍼플라워 2025 하반기 설문조사 이벤트 진행
인텔 코어 울트라7
jQuery를 4.0.0 마이그레이션 방법 공유합니다. 1단계: jQuery Migrate 플러그인 사용 (가장 중요) jQuery 팀은 업그레이드 시 발생하는 문제를 자동으로 감지하고 해결책을 제시하는 jQuery Migrate 4.0.0 플러그인을 함께 제공합니다. 개발 환경에 추가: 기존 jQuery를 4.0.0으로 교체한 직후, Migrate 플러그인을 로드합니다. <script src="https://code.jquery.com/jquery-4.0.0.js"></script> <script src="https://code.jquery.com/jquery-migrate-4.0.0.js"></script> 2. 브라우저 개발자 도구(F12)의 콘솔창을 확인합니다. 삭제된 함수를 사용 중이라면 경고(Warning)와 함께 교체해야 할 함수 정보가 나타납니다. 3. 코드 수정: 경고가 나타나지 않을 때까지 코드를 수정한 뒤, 최종 배포 시에는 Migrate 플러그인을 제거합니다. 2단계: 삭제된 API를 네이티브 자바스크립트로 교체 4.0.0에서는 예전부터 "사용 권장 안 함(Deprecated)"이었던 유틸리티 함수들이 대거 삭제되었습니다. 이제는 브라우저 내장 함수(Native JS)를 사용해야 합니다. 삭제된 함수 현대적인 대체 코드 (Native JS) jQuery.trim(str) str.trim() jQuery.isArray(obj) Array.isArray(obj) jQuery.parseJSON(str) JSON.parse(str) jQuery.now() Date.now() jQuery.isFunction(obj) typeof obj === "function" jQuery.type(obj) Object.prototype.toString.call(obj) 등 3단계: 브라우저 지원 범위 확인 마이그레이션 전, 서비스의 지원 대상을 확인해야 합니다. IE 10 이하: 더 이상 지원하지 않습니다. 만약 IE 10 이하를 반드시 지원해야 한다면 jQuery 3.x에 머물러야 합니다. IE 11: 지원은 하지만 "최소한의 수준"이며, 다음 버전인 5.0에서는 완전히 제거될 예정입니다. Edge: 레거시 Edge(크로미움 이전 버전) 지원이 중단되었습니다. 4단계: ES 모듈(ESM) 활용 // npm으로 설치한 경우 import $ from 'jquery'; // 브라우저에서 직접 모듈로 호출 <script type="module"> import $ from 'https://code.jquery.com/jquery-4.0.0.js'; $('body').append('<h1>Hello jQuery 4!</h1>'); </script> 5단계: 주요 변경 사항 및 주의점 AJAX 내부 동작 과거에는 $.ajax로 스크립트를 요청하면 인라인으로 실행했으나, 이제는 실제 <script> 태그를 생성하여 실행합니다. 이는 보안 정책(CSP) 준수를 위함입니다. 이벤트 시스템 jQuery.event.props 및 jQuery.event.fixHooks가 제거되었습니다. 아주 오래된 플러그인을 사용 중이라면 이 부분에서 오류가 날 수 있습니다. Trusted Types 보안이 강화된 환경(CSP 설정 등)에서 DOM에 HTML을 삽입할 때 발생하던 보안 경고를 jQuery가 자체적으로 처리하기 시작했습니다. link : 마이그레이션 공식 문서
2026.01.20
0
0
인사이 댓글 이벤트
  • 종합
  • 뉴스/정보
  • 커뮤니티
  • 질문/토론